Transaction 77ebf1909794de4b4bd0fbc4ffdbdc0be766cfc5ae748ac9b689b1f91a14e03b
1 Input
1 Output
-
77ebf1909794de4b4bd0fbc4ffdbdc0be766cfc5ae748ac9b689b1f91a14e03b:0
- value
- 595943
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f54a8ceb07240db96dd549ac357c2f11d326a2c
- address
- bc1q3a223n4swfqdh9ka2jdvx47z7ywny63vyhgll5